...22 * The URI of the supported specification document.23 */​24 const SUPPORTED_SPECIFICATION_PERMALINK = 'http:/​/​jsonapi.org/​format/​1.0/​';25 /​**26 * Member name: globally allowed characters.27 *28 * U+0080 and above (non-ASCII Unicode characters) are allowed, but are not29 * URL-safe. It is RECOMMENDED to not use them.30 *31 * A character class, for use in regular expressions.32 *33 * @see http:/​/​jsonapi.org/​format/​#document-member-names-allowed-characters34 * @see http:/​/​php.net/​manual/​en/​regexp.reference.character-classes.php35 */​36 const MEMBER_NAME_GLOBALLY_ALLOWED_CHARACTER_CLASS = '[a-zA-Z0-9\x{80}-\x{10FFFF}]';37 /​**38 * Member name: allowed characters except as the first or last character.39 *40 * Space (U+0020) is allowed, but is not URL-safe. It is RECOMMENDED to not41 * use it.42 *43 * A character class, for use in regular expressions.44 *45 * @see http:/​/​jsonapi.org/​format/​#document-member-names-allowed-characters46 * @see http:/​/​php.net/​manual/​en/​regexp.reference.character-classes.php47 */​48 const MEMBER_NAME_INNER_ALLOWED_CHARACTERS = "[a-zA-Z0-9\x{80}-\x{10FFFF}\-_ ]";49 /​**50 * Regular expression to check the validity of a member name.51 */​52 const MEMBER_NAME_REGEXP = '/​^' .53 /​/​ First character must be "globally allowed". Length must be >=1.54 self::MEMBER_NAME_GLOBALLY_ALLOWED_CHARACTER_CLASS . '{1}(' .55 /​/​ As many non-globally allowed characters as desired.56 self::MEMBER_NAME_INNER_ALLOWED_CHARACTERS . '*' .57 /​/​ If length > 1, then it must end in a "globally allowed" character.58 self::MEMBER_NAME_GLOBALLY_ALLOWED_CHARACTER_CLASS . '{1}' .59 /​/​ >1 characters is optional.60 ')?$/​u';61 /​**62 * Checks whether the given member name is valid.63 *64 * Requirements:65 * - it MUST contain at least one character.66 * - it MUST contain only the allowed characters67 * - it MUST start and end with a "globally allowed character"68 *69 * @param string $member_name70 * A member name to validate.71 *72 * @return bool73 * Whether the given member name is in compliance with the JSON:API74 * specification.75 *76 * @see http:/​/​jsonapi.org/​format/​#document-member-names77 */​78 public static function isValidMemberName($member_name) {79 return preg_match(static::MEMBER_NAME_REGEXP, $member_name) === 1;80 }81 /​**82 * The reserved (official) query parameters.83 */​84 const RESERVED_QUERY_PARAMETERS = [85 'filter',86 'sort',87 'page',88 'fields',89 'include',90 ];91 /​**92 * The query parameter for providing a version (revision) value.93 *94 * @var string95 */​96 const VERSION_QUERY_PARAMETER = 'resourceVersion';97 /​**98 * Gets the reserved (official) JSON:API query parameters.99 *100 * @return string[]101 * Gets the query parameters reserved by the specification.102 */​103 public static function getReservedQueryParameters() {104 return static::RESERVED_QUERY_PARAMETERS;105 }106 /​**107 * Checks whether the given custom query parameter name is valid.108 *109 * A custom query parameter name must be a valid member name, with one110 * additional requirement: it MUST contain at least one non a-z character.111 *112 * Requirements:113 * - it MUST contain at least one character.114 * - it MUST contain only the allowed characters115 * - it MUST start and end with a "globally allowed character"116 * - it MUST contain at least none a-z (U+0061 to U+007A) character117 *118 * It is RECOMMENDED that a hyphen (U+002D), underscore (U+005F) or capital119 * letter is used (i.e. camelCasing).120 *121 * @param string $custom_query_parameter_name122 * A custom query parameter name to validate.123 *124 * @return bool125 * Whether the given query parameter is in compliance with the JSON:API126 * specification.127 *128 * @see http:/​/​jsonapi.org/​format/​#query-parameters129 */​...
